Overview
Drawer-type deodorization equipment represents an efficient solution for industrial and commercial odor management. These systems are characterized by their distinctive modular design, allowing for easy access to filtration components through sliding drawer mechanisms. The technology addresses growing environmental concerns and regulatory requirements regarding air quality in processing facilities. The equipment's popularity stems from its operational flexibility, with configurations available for different odor removal methods including activated carbon adsorption, chemical neutralization, and biological treatment. Manufacturers typically offer standardized sizes with customizable media options to handle specific odor profiles encountered across industries.
Structure and Working Principle
The system comprises multiple stacked drawers housed within a corrosion-resistant cabinet, each containing specialized filtration media. Contaminated air enters through the intake and passes sequentially through the media layers, where odor molecules are captured or transformed into non-odorous compounds. Activated carbon models physically adsorb volatile organic compounds, while chemical scrubber versions use reactive solutions to neutralize acidic or alkaline odors. Biological variants employ microorganisms to biologically degrade organic odor sources. The modular design allows operators to replace or service individual drawers without shutting down the entire system, significantly reducing maintenance downtime.
Key Features
Modern drawer-type deodorizers incorporate several technological advancements. Many models feature differential pressure sensors to monitor media saturation, alerting operators when replacement is needed. Anti-microbial coatings are increasingly common in biological systems to prevent pathogen growth. Energy efficiency is achieved through optimized airflow designs that minimize pressure drop across the system. High-end units may include IoT connectivity for remote monitoring of performance metrics. The equipment's compact footprint allows installation in space-constrained areas, with vertical configurations maximizing treatment capacity per square meter of floor space.
Application Areas
Primary applications include wastewater treatment plants handling sludge processing, where hydrogen sulfide and ammonia odors are prevalent. Food processing facilities use these systems to control emissions from rendering, fermentation, or cooking operations. In the chemical industry, drawer-type deodorizers manage volatile organic compound (VOC) emissions during production and storage. Commercial applications extend to waste transfer stations, composting facilities, and even large-scale restaurant kitchens. The technology's scalability makes it equally suitable for point-source odor control and whole-facility air treatment scenarios.
Maintenance and Precautions
Routine maintenance involves periodic inspection of media condition, typically every 3-6 months depending on odor load. Activated carbon requires complete replacement when saturated, while chemical media may need replenishment of reactive solutions. Biological systems demand careful monitoring of moisture levels and microbial activity. Operators should wear appropriate PPE during media changes, particularly when handling spent chemical or biological media. System housings should be inspected for corrosion, especially in high-humidity environments. Proper disposal of exhausted media is critical to meet environmental regulations, with some suppliers offering take-back programs.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ring drawer-type deodorization systems, buyers should first conduct comprehensive odor characterization to identify target pollutants and their concentrations. This determines the appropriate media type and required contact time. Key procurement considerations include: airflow capacity (measured in m³/h), expected media lifespan, power consumption, and noise levels. Leading manufacturers typically provide performance data from independent testing. Buyers should verify compliance with local air quality regulations and inquire about after-sales support for media replacement and technical servicing.
